Associated Press: Cyprus issues temporary vaccination certificate for travel

 Αssociated Press reports from Nicosia that Cyprus says it will issue a temporary COVID-19 vaccination certificate to individuals planning on traveling abroad this month.

The Cypriot government said in a statement on Tuesday that the certificate is a stop-gap measure until the European Union starts issuing its own digital vaccination certificates.

The Cypriot document, which will be in Greek and English, will only be valid until July 1, when the EU certificates are scheduled to be available.
